New technology improves performance and environmental friendliness
Traditional vending machine motors are mostly driven by a single motor, which has problems such as high power consumption and loud operating noise. Today, many manufacturers are adopting brushless DC motor (BLDC) technology. This technology significantly improves motor efficiency and life by reducing mechanical friction, while reducing noise and maintenance costs. In addition, a new motor combined with a low-energy driver chip can intelligently adjust power output when the vending machine is in sleep or standby mode, further reducing energy consumption.
Precise control improves user experience
The new motor technology also greatly improves the precise control capabilities of vending machines. By being equipped with sensors and feedback control systems, the motor can adjust the speed and torque in real time to achieve high-precision control of product push and access. This not only reduces product jamming, but also avoids product damage due to improper force, and improves user experience.
Intelligence promotes industry upgrading
It is worth noting that intelligence is empowering the motor design of vending machines. For example, some high-end vending machines have begun to use Internet of Things (IoT) technology to connect their motors to cloud platforms to achieve remote monitoring and diagnosis. When an abnormality occurs in the motor, the system can automatically generate an alarm to remind the operator to perform maintenance or replacement to avoid sales losses due to equipment failure. In addition, through data analysis, operators can optimize the product replenishment and operational efficiency of vending machines.
